Track 01
Innovations in Gastrointestinal Endoscopy

This track focuses on the latest advancements in gastrointestinal endoscopic procedures and technologies. Topics include endoscopic ultrasound, mucosal resection techniques, and the role of endoscopy in diagnosing complex gastrointestinal conditions.

Track 02
Advances in Gastrointestinal Surgery

This session will explore cutting-edge surgical techniques and approaches in gastrointestinal surgery. Emphasis will be placed on minimally invasive procedures and their outcomes in various gastrointestinal disorders.

Track 03
Clinical Nutrition in Gastrointestinal Disorders

This track aims to address the critical role of nutrition in managing gastrointestinal diseases. Discussions will include dietary interventions, nutritional assessment, and the impact of nutrition on treatment outcomes.

Track 04
Emerging Therapies for Liver Diseases

This session will highlight novel therapeutic approaches for managing liver diseases, including viral hepatitis and liver fibrosis. Participants will discuss the efficacy and safety of new pharmacological agents and treatment protocols.

Track 05
Gastroenteritis and Associated Diseases

This track will delve into the pathophysiology, diagnosis, and management of gastroenteritis and its related conditions. Emphasis will be placed on emerging infectious agents and their clinical implications.

Track 06
Inflammatory Bowel Disease: Recent Advances

This session will cover the latest research and clinical practices in the management of inflammatory bowel disease (IBD). Topics will include novel therapies, patient management strategies, and long-term outcomes.

Track 07
Gastrointestinal Oncology: Current Trends

This track will focus on the latest developments in the diagnosis and treatment of gastrointestinal cancers. Discussions will include screening protocols, targeted therapies, and the role of multidisciplinary teams in patient care.

Track 08
Endoscopic Techniques for GI Bleeding Management

This session will explore the various endoscopic techniques employed in the management of gastrointestinal bleeding. Participants will discuss indications, procedural techniques, and outcomes associated with these interventions.

Track 09
Public Health Perspectives in Gastroenterology

This track will address the public health implications of gastrointestinal diseases and their management. Topics will include epidemiology, health policy, and strategies for improving gastrointestinal health at the population level.

Track 10
Gynecological Considerations in Gastrointestinal Health

This session will explore the intersection of gynecology and gastrointestinal health, focusing on conditions that affect both systems. Discussions will include the impact of hormonal changes on gastrointestinal disorders and vice versa.

Track 11
Future Directions in Gastroenterology Research

This track will highlight emerging research trends and future directions in the field of gastroenterology. Participants will discuss innovative studies, potential breakthroughs, and the implications for clinical practice.
